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Transmission optimization method, and mapping information storage method, device and system

A technology for mapping information and storage systems, applied in transmission systems, digital transmission systems, electrical components, etc., can solve the problems of occupying bandwidth resources and increasing the burden on ALTO servers, and achieve the effect of reducing load and traffic consumption

Active Publication Date: 2012-07-04
HUAWEI TECH CO LTD
View PDF4 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] As shown in Figure 1-b, for each service request, the ALTO client sends a query request to the ALTO server to obtain the latest network mapping table and path cost table, assuming that under the ALTO architecture, the mapping information has not changed for a long period of time Or update, obviously there are a lot of redundant query request / response interaction messages between ALTO client and ALTO server, these redundant query request / response interaction messages occupy a lot of limited bandwidth resources and aggravate ALTO server load

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Transmission optimization method, and mapping information storage method, device and system
  • Transmission optimization method, and mapping information storage method, device and system
  • Transmission optimization method, and mapping information storage method, device and system

Examples

Experimental program
Comparison scheme
Effect test

example 3

[0157]512. Based on the relationship between the PID and the expiration time parameter, the ALTO client performs expiration verification on the Network Map. If the mapping information related to PID1 and PID2 in the Network Map expires and fails, an HTTP POST is sent to the ALTO server. The HTTP POST carries PID1 and PID2 to request the ALTO server to return the Filtered Network Map (that is, the mapping information related to PID1 and PID2, the mapping information related to PID1 and PID2 contains the corresponding expiration time parameters), see Example 3 in Section 2.2 below;

[0158] Specifically, the query request for the Filtered Network Map may also be an HTTP GET message.

[0159] 513. The ALTO client receives the 200OK returned by the ALTO server, and the 200OK carries a Filtered Network Map, wherein the Filtered Network Map has an expiration time parameter;

[0160] 514. The ALTO client updates the stored Network Map at the entire network layer level, and establishe...

example 1

[0175]

[0176]

example 2

[0178]

[0179]

[0180]

[0181] 2.2. The following example shows the scenario where the ALTO client queries the Filtered Network Map with HTTP POST and the ALTO server returns the Filtered Network Map with an expiration time parameter. The ALTO client establishes the association between the subnetwork level mapping information and the expiration time parameter. Once expired, the ALTO client initiates a new query only for mapping information at the subnetwork level, thereby avoiding additional load on the network.

[0182] Example 3:

[0183]

[0184]

[0185] 2.3 The following example shows the scenario where the ALTO client queries the Cost Map with HTTP GET and the ALTO server returns the Cost Map.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ention discloses a transmission optimization method, a mapping information storage method, an application layer traffic optimization (ALTO) client, an ALTO server and an ALTO system. The transmission optimization method comprises the following steps of: when a next-hop node is required to be determined for service, checking whether a storage system associated with the ALTO client stores mapping information or not; and if the storage system associated with the ALTO client stores the mapping information of a first sub-network level and the mapping information of the first sub-network level is unexpired and valid, determining a next-hop node set on the basis of an information source comprising the network address of a service request node and the mapping information of the first sub-network level, wherein the next-hop node set comprises one or more service provision nodes, and the service request node belongs to a first sub-network. Therefore, the consumption of redundant query request and response message interaction between the ALTO client and the ALTO server in the traffic of the whole backbone network is reduced, and the load of the backbone network is reduced.

Description

technical field [0001] The invention relates to the field of network technology, in particular to a transmission optimization method, a storage method, device and system for mapping information. Background technique [0002] Distributed applications such as file sharing, streaming media broadcast or on-demand, voice communication and online game support platforms generally use a considerable amount of network resources on the network. Usually, these applications transmit a large amount of data by establishing connections between nodes distributed throughout the network. Most applications randomly select a subset from a large set of nodes to exchange data, and the underlying network topology is known. very little. As shown in Figure 1-a, many current P2P (Peer to Peer, peer-to-peer network) systems directly form an overlay network by peer-to-peer connections, and the overlay network is composed of nodes distributed in multiple service provider network ISPs , when two node p...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L29/08H04L12/56H04L12/801
Inventor 李明华
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products